Security readout for executives and security teams
Plain-English summary
CVE-2022-36661 is a denial-of-service issue in xhyve. A NULL pointer dereference in vi_pci_read() can crash affected software, disrupting availability. The public record does not identify precise affected versions or attack vectors beyond the referenced commit, so exposure depends on whether an organization runs that vulnerable xhyve code.

Technical view
The CVE describes a CWE-476 NULL pointer dereference in xhyve commit dfbe09b, specifically vi_pci_read(). CVSS 3.1 is 6.5 with availability impact high, low attack complexity, low privileges, and no user interaction. The public source bundle does not name patched versions, affected CPEs, or detailed trigger conditions.
Likely exposure
Exposure is likely limited to environments running xhyve or downstream builds containing commit dfbe09b. The CVE record lists affected vendor, product, versions, and CPEs as unavailable, so asset confirmation is required before prioritizing broadly.
Exploitation context
The provided sources do not show CISA KEV listing or active exploitation. The vulnerability is described as denial of service through unspecified vectors, so assume crash potential where vulnerable xhyve code is reachable by a low-privileged actor until vendor guidance clarifies scope.

Mitigation direction
- Inventory xhyve deployments and downstream forks for commit dfbe09b or matching vi_pci_read() code.
- Check xhyve maintainer or downstream vendor guidance for fixed builds before changing production systems.
- Restrict access to systems and interfaces that can exercise xhyve runtime or management functionality.
- Increase monitoring for xhyve crashes or availability failures in affected virtualization hosts.
Validation and detection
- Confirm whether any production image, package, or source checkout includes xhyve commit dfbe09b.
- Review crash logs for NULL pointer dereference indicators involving vi_pci_read().
- Map users or services with low-privilege access to affected xhyve functionality.
- Verify any upgraded or replaced build no longer contains the vulnerable code path.
